SAN JUAN CAPISTRANO PARKS


ACU CANYON PARK


Whether you are planning a family get-together or just looking to get away from it all, San Juan Capistrano’s parks and open space can cater to all your outdoor needs. From playgrounds for kids and dog parks for man’s best friend to larger spaces for barbecues, weddings and other group events, finding a place to enjoy the fresh air and scenery in San Juan Capistrano is a walk in the park.


Acu Canyon Park


CAMINO LAS RAMBLAS, EAST OF AVENIDA PESCADOR Small ballfields, children’s play area with swings, tunnels and slides and room to run on a grassy field. Also has a portable restroom.


Arce Park


DEL OBISPO AND ALIPAZ STREETS A neighborhood pocket park.


Arroyo Park


CALLE ARROYO AND VIA PARRA A nice greenbelt park with plenty of room to run around or just sit and enjoy a quiet mo- ment. Adjacent to trails.


Bonita Park VIA DEL REY AND AVENIDA ROMERO A neighborhood park with a swing, slide and climber.


Cook Del Campo Park CALLE ARROYO AND CALLE DEL CAMPO An open grassy area with swings, a slide and a climber.


Cook La Novia Park LA NOVIA AND CALLE ARROYO Park features barbecues, playground equip- ment, picnic tables, restrooms, volleyball/bas- ketball court and baseball field. Baseball field available for rent.


Cook Cordova Park CALLE ARROYO AT VIA CORDOVA Known to any parent of a soccer, baseball or soſtball player, Cook Cordova is home to three of the city’s nine fields. Te park also has a restroom and two concrete fire rings with grills.

De La Vista Park AVENIDA DE LA VISTA, SOUTH END A small neighborhood park with a picnic table.


Descanso Park


32506 PASEO ADELANTO/ BEHIND THE DANCE HALL Te park features barbecues, playground equip- ment, picnic tables, restrooms, horseshoe pits and a small equestrian arena.


Dr. Joe Cortese Dog Park 30291 CAMINO CAPISTRANO Te city’s first dedicated dog park is named aſter the late veterinarian Dr. Joe Cortese. Cortese was a passionate leader in veterinary medicine and a beloved member of the com- munity. Te park is located on a 2.5-acre site in the city’s northwest open space.
